I have 9 days and a few hours to go until I fly off to the most magical place on earth. 2 weeks ago, we called and scheduled Magical Express...and we have not recieved our luggage tags yet.

On this site, it says they arrive 10-15 days before your departure. I'm getting worried...should I be?

Even if you never get your packets you have NOTHING to worry about.

First thing to do, call DME (866-599-0951) to confirm that you have a reservation. Actually having a reservation in their computer is the only make-or-break item.

If you don't get your packet, STILL skip baggage claim and go directly to the DME Welcome Center. When you check in, they will ask if your luggage has DME tags on it. When you tell them it doesn't, they will ask to see your baggage claim checks to get the numbers from them. They'll also show you a ohoto array of every piece of luggage known to man, and you'll visually identify your luggage. With all of this info, they'll dispatch a CM to claim your luggage at baggage claim for you, and then bring it back behind-the-scenes and send it along with the other DME luggage slated for delivery to resorts. At the DME Welcome Center, they'll also give you bus vouchers.

See?! Even without the DME packet, you'll be just fine. No worries. Enjoy your vacation!

If you don't get tags, as stated you can still use the service.

One thing I did that helped speed up the process was to take a picture of my luggage with my digital camera before leaving and print it off. I would've taken hours to find my luggage style on their chart, but with the picture, the CM at DME was able to ident the type of bag in their system right away :D

A simple hint to save a bit of time if you have a digital camera [or a polaroid would work too].
